The question is, can she rescue him? I've recently begun writing short fiction, something I love doing but put on hold as I was writing novels. Now, thanks to some amazingly talented fellow authors at Prairie Rose Publishing, I've had the delightful opportunity to write a series of short pieces, all Western historical romances, and all with at least a touch – and sometimes much more – of the supernatural. The stories all have a tie-in with a holiday or special time of year, and there's something for everyone, thanks to a roster of outstanding Western writers! Love some thrills and chills along with heartfelt Western romance? That's exactly what you'll find in my story “The Sheriff of Hel'n Gone” in COWBOYS, CREATURES, AND CALICO! Courageous Christmas is a time of memories, family, and surprises. A very big surprise is in store for former Union Army officer Will Blackburn, whose decision to fight for the United States cost him his home and family in Georgia. Forging a new start in Nevada, he is trying to put the past behind him. Then, one December day, a young woman arrives at the train depot bearing a most unexpected “Christmas Treasure.” Read my story of hope and love in PRESENT FOR A COWBOY. Love and fate – what forces could be more powerful and magical? In my story “A Kiss in Time” from COWBOY KISSES, a tattered old diary sends a young woman into the arms of a long-ago Texas Ranger. Can love overcome the impossible gulf of time that separates them?
